Population Proportions
Fractions or percentages of a population that fall into various categories, often used in polling and survey results.
Estimator
A statistic used to estimate the value of a population parameter.
Simple Linear Regression
A statistical method that models the relationship between a dependent variable and one independent variable by fitting a linear equation to observed data.
Confidence Interval
A range of values derived from sample data that is likely to contain the true value of an unknown population parameter, expressed at a given confidence level.
